The File Explorer Revolution: Tabs and Native Archive Support

Perhaps the most immediately noticeable productivity enhancement in Windows 11 is the introduction of tabbed File Explorer. For decades, Windows users have juggled multiple Explorer windows or resorted to third-party solutions like Clover or QTTabBar to manage their file navigation. Windows 11 finally brings this functionality natively, allowing users to open multiple folders in a single window with clean, browser-like tabs. This seemingly simple addition has profound implications for workflow efficiency.

According to Microsoft's documentation, the tabbed interface supports standard keyboard shortcuts (Ctrl+T for new tabs, Ctrl+W to close them) and allows users to drag tabs between windows or organize them into groups. The implementation feels intuitive for anyone familiar with modern web browsers, reducing the cognitive load of managing multiple file locations. Users report that this feature alone has transformed how they handle tasks like comparing folder contents, moving files between directories, or working with project files spread across different locations.

Equally significant is Windows 11's improved native support for archive files. While previous Windows versions included basic ZIP functionality, Windows 11 expands this with native support for additional formats including RAR, 7-Zip, TAR, and GZ files through the libarchive open-source library. This means users can now extract these common archive formats without installing third-party software like WinRAR or 7-Zip. The integration is seamless—right-click on an archive file, and you'll find extraction options directly in the context menu. For power users, this eliminates one more piece of software to maintain and update, while for casual users, it removes the friction of finding and installing extraction tools.

Snap Layouts and Virtual Desktops: Mastering Window Management

Window management has long been a pain point in Windows, with users developing elaborate workarounds to organize their applications across increasingly large and high-resolution displays. Windows 11's Snap Layouts feature addresses this by providing intelligent, visual window arrangement options that appear when you hover over a window's maximize button or press Windows+Z.

The system offers various layout templates depending on your screen size and orientation, from simple side-by-side arrangements to more complex grids for larger monitors. What makes Snap Layouts particularly useful is their persistence—when you snap one window into a layout, Windows suggests other open applications to fill the remaining slots, creating complete workspaces with minimal effort. This feature shines on ultrawide monitors where traditional manual window arrangement can be tedious.

Complementing Snap Layouts are enhanced Virtual Desktops, which have evolved significantly from their Windows 10 implementation. Windows 11 allows users to create separate desktop environments for different tasks or projects, each with its own wallpaper and set of applications. The Task View interface (Windows+Tab) makes switching between these desktops intuitive, and users can move windows between desktops with simple drag-and-drop. This feature has proven particularly valuable for users who need to context-switch between work projects, personal tasks, or gaming sessions without cluttering a single desktop with dozens of windows.

OCR and Accessibility: Hidden Productivity Powerhouses

One of Windows 11's most underrated productivity features is its built-in Optical Character Recognition (OCR) capability, accessible through the Snipping Tool and other applications. This allows users to capture text from images, PDFs, or even video frames and convert it to editable, searchable text. The implications for research, documentation, and data entry are substantial.

The OCR functionality works surprisingly well with various fonts and layouts, supporting multiple languages and offering reasonable accuracy even with less-than-perfect source images. Users have reported using this feature to extract text from scanned documents, capture information from web pages that don't allow copying, or digitize notes from whiteboard photos. When combined with Windows 11's improved clipboard history (Windows+V), which now stores text, images, and formatted content, these tools create a powerful ecosystem for information gathering and organization.

Beyond OCR, Windows 11 includes numerous smaller accessibility improvements that benefit all users. The redesigned Quick Settings panel offers one-click access to commonly used functions, while improved touch gestures and voice typing (with offline support) provide alternative input methods that can boost efficiency in specific scenarios. Looking Forward: The Evolution Continues

Microsoft continues to refine these productivity features through regular updates. Recent Windows 11 versions have added improvements like better tab management in File Explorer (including tab tearing and grouping), additional Snap Layout templates for ultrawide monitors, and enhancements to the OCR engine's accuracy and language support. The company appears committed to this incremental improvement approach, suggesting that future updates will continue to polish rather than overhaul these core productivity tools.
